1. The uses of polishing wheels and grinding wheels are different
Polishing wheels are mainly used to polish the surfaces of metals, wood, and other materials to make their surfaces smoother and glossier. Grinding wheels are primarily used in the cutting, grinding, and finishing of metals, stones, glass, ceramics, and other materials.
2. Materials
Polishing wheels are generally made of natural or synthetic velvet, wool, and other fiber materials, and different particles of abrasive materials are added to the inside for manufacturing. Grinding wheels mainly use wear-resistant materials such as aluminum oxide, silicon carbide, and diamonds, and the internal composition and density are also very tight.
3. Manufacturing process
The manufacturing process of polishing wheels is relatively simple, mainly selecting different velvet, wool, and other fiber materials, adding different particles of abrasive materials as needed, and then making them through heating, pressing, drying, and other processes. Grinding wheels require multiple mixing, processing, drying and other complex processes to be made.
4. Effect after processing
Because the velvet, wool, and other fiber materials of the polishing wheel have good softness, and the abrasive material particles added inside are relatively small, the polishing wheel can grind and polish the material more carefully to achieve a smoother and glossier effect. The grinding wheel has a relatively rough processing effect due to its high hardness, but it can quickly cut and grind materials to improve processing efficiency.
In summary, although the polishing wheel and the grinding wheel are similar in appearance, they are different in use, materials, manufacturing process, processing effect, etc. In actual processing operations, the appropriate grinding wheel and polishing wheel should be selected according to the processing materials and processing procedures to achieve the best processing effect.
